Gino Tutera, MD, FACOG, is a practicing OB/GYN physician who has been treating menopause and hormonal imbalance for over thirty years. Dr. Tutera opened his first SottoPelle® clinic, devoted to hormonal replacement, in Rancho Mirage, California, in 1992, and currently practices in that office as well as his office in Scottsdale, AZ. He has recently completed ten years of documented research on the reduction of breast and ovarian cancer through pellet hormone replacement therapy. Dr. Tutera is committed to elevating this therapy to a level where it is available for every woman and man in America who wants or needs it.
